Mumbai: As India gears up for the celebration of its 72nd Republic Day, Republic Media Network brings to you an exclusive broadcast series from the valley of Kashmir. Republic Media Network s senior consulting editor - strategic affairs major Gaurav Arya (retd.) is all set to take India and viewers across the world to the heart of counter-terror operations at Handwara with 7 Sector Rashtriya Rifles, also known as the Rajwar Tigers.
The Rajwar Tigers are at the forefront of the counter-terror operations in north Kashmir. The four-episode series will make for unmissable viewing with major Arya taking the audience to ground zero and giving them an up close and personal peek into how operations are carried out.

New Delhi: As millions of PUBG Mobile fans are eagerly awaiting for the re-entry of the game in India, rumours are strong that PUBG Mobile India would re-enter in the country in the coming days.
According to a few media reports, PUBG can be relaunched between January second and third week. However, another media report said that there seems no possibility in sight for the game to be launched in the country before March.
The company had made two big announcements in December 2020, that further aided in building hopes of PUBG India fans higher. Parent company Krafton Inc had also recently appointed Aneesh Aravind as new country manager for India. As per a report, Krafton Inc has got more people on board by inducting four more people to the team. Notably, these four people were part of Tencent, the company responsible for rights for PUBG Mobile s Global version.
